SlideShare uma empresa Scribd logo
1 de 11
INTEGRANTES ,[object Object]
NARCISA OSTAIZA LOOR
ING.  PATRICIO QUIROZ,[object Object]
Los componentes lógicos incluyen, entre muchos otros, las aplicaciones informáticas; tales como el procesador de textos, que permite al usuario realizar todas las tareas concernientes a la edición de textos; el software de sistema, tal como el sistema operativo, que, básicamente, permite al resto de los programas funcionar adecuadamente, facilitando también la interacción entre los componentes físicos y el resto de las aplicaciones, y proporcionando una interfaz para el usuario.
ETIMOLOGÍA Software (pronunciación AFI:[soft'ɣware])es una palabra proveniente del inglés (literalmente: partes blandas o suaves), que en español no posee una traducción adecuada al contexto, por lo cual se la utiliza asiduamente sin traducir y así fue admitida por la Real Academia Española (RAE).Aunque no es estrictamente lo mismo, suele sustituirse por expresiones tales como programas (informáticos) o aplicaciones (informáticas). Software es lo que se denomina producto en Ingeniería de Software
DEFINICIÓN DE SOFTWARE Existen varias definiciones similares aceptadas para software, pero probablemente la más formal sea la siguiente: Es el conjunto de los programas de cómputo, procedimientos, reglas, documentación y datos asociados que forman parte de las operaciones de un sistema de computación.
Considerando esta definición, el concepto de software va más allá de los programas de computación en sus distintos estados: código fuente, binario o ejecutable; también su documentación, los datos a procesar e incluso la información de usuario forman parte del software: es decir, abarca todo lo intangible, todo lo «no físico» relacionado. El término «software» fue usado por primera vez en este sentido por John W. Tukey en 1957. En la ingeniería de software y las ciencias de la computación, el software es toda la información procesada por los sistemas informáticos: programas y datos. El concepto de leer diferentes secuencias de instrucciones (programa) desde la memoria de un dispositivo para controlar los cálculos fue introducido por Charles Babbage como parte de su máquina diferencial. La teoría que forma la base de la mayor parte del software moderno fue propuesta por Alan Turing en su ensayo de 1936, «Los números computables», con una aplicación al problema de decisión.
CLASIFICACIÓN DEL SOFTWARE Software de sistema: Su objetivo es desvincular adecuadamente al usuario y al programador de los detalles de la computadora en particular que se use, aislándolo especialmente del procesamiento referido a las características internas de: memoria, discos, puertos y dispositivos de comunicaciones, impresoras, pantallas, teclados, etc. El software de sistema le procura al usuario y programador adecuadas interfaces de alto nivel, herramientas y utilidades de apoyo que permiten su mantenimiento. Incluye entre otros:  Sistemas operativos Controladores de dispositivos Herramientas de diagnóstico Herramientas de Corrección y Optimización Servidores Utilidades
Software de programación: Es el conjunto de herramientas que permiten al programador desarrollar programas informáticos, usando diferentes alternativas y lenguajes de programación, de una manera práctica. Incluye entre otros:  ,[object Object]
Compiladores
Intérpretes

Mais conteúdo relacionado

Mais procurados (13)

Diapo tic software
Diapo tic softwareDiapo tic software
Diapo tic software
 
Tra.de manten
Tra.de mantenTra.de manten
Tra.de manten
 
Software de aplicacion general
Software de aplicacion generalSoftware de aplicacion general
Software de aplicacion general
 
Hardware y software
Hardware y softwareHardware y software
Hardware y software
 
Tics
TicsTics
Tics
 
marco geronzi soy rre piola
marco geronzi soy rre piolamarco geronzi soy rre piola
marco geronzi soy rre piola
 
Software
SoftwareSoftware
Software
 
actividad 10
actividad 10actividad 10
actividad 10
 
actividad 10
actividad 10actividad 10
actividad 10
 
Software
SoftwareSoftware
Software
 
Que es el Software?
Que es el Software?Que es el Software?
Que es el Software?
 
Tipos de Software
Tipos de SoftwareTipos de Software
Tipos de Software
 
Preparación e instalación del software de aplicación
Preparación e instalación del software de aplicaciónPreparación e instalación del software de aplicación
Preparación e instalación del software de aplicación
 

Destaque

上帝手中的作品
上帝手中的作品上帝手中的作品
上帝手中的作品士勤 陳
 
世界上迷人的地方
世界上迷人的地方世界上迷人的地方
世界上迷人的地方psjlew
 
仙境鬼斧神工(奇特的綿山)
仙境鬼斧神工(奇特的綿山)仙境鬼斧神工(奇特的綿山)
仙境鬼斧神工(奇特的綿山)士勤 陳
 
綠島海底最Hot的明星
綠島海底最Hot的明星綠島海底最Hot的明星
綠島海底最Hot的明星Jaing Lai
 
世界最美的瀑布
世界最美的瀑布世界最美的瀑布
世界最美的瀑布Jaing Lai
 
人体藝術
人体藝術人体藝術
人体藝術Jaing Lai
 
8.2 la monarquía hispánica de felipe ii
8.2 la monarquía hispánica de felipe ii8.2 la monarquía hispánica de felipe ii
8.2 la monarquía hispánica de felipe iifonssytohh
 
春天來臨九族村 -王英明攝
春天來臨九族村 -王英明攝春天來臨九族村 -王英明攝
春天來臨九族村 -王英明攝Jaing Lai
 
椅子正在謀殺你
椅子正在謀殺你椅子正在謀殺你
椅子正在謀殺你psjlew
 
1百花盛開
1百花盛開1百花盛開
1百花盛開Jaing Lai
 
獨特的地方
獨特的地方獨特的地方
獨特的地方Jaing Lai
 
彩筆下的威尼斯
彩筆下的威尼斯彩筆下的威尼斯
彩筆下的威尼斯秀玲 楊
 

Destaque (20)

上帝手中的作品
上帝手中的作品上帝手中的作品
上帝手中的作品
 
世界上迷人的地方
世界上迷人的地方世界上迷人的地方
世界上迷人的地方
 
仙境鬼斧神工(奇特的綿山)
仙境鬼斧神工(奇特的綿山)仙境鬼斧神工(奇特的綿山)
仙境鬼斧神工(奇特的綿山)
 
Lego en Berlín
Lego en BerlínLego en Berlín
Lego en Berlín
 
綠島海底最Hot的明星
綠島海底最Hot的明星綠島海底最Hot的明星
綠島海底最Hot的明星
 
Shibam
ShibamShibam
Shibam
 
世界最美的瀑布
世界最美的瀑布世界最美的瀑布
世界最美的瀑布
 
Prece De Todo Dia. Jr Cordeiro.
Prece  De Todo Dia. Jr Cordeiro.Prece  De Todo Dia. Jr Cordeiro.
Prece De Todo Dia. Jr Cordeiro.
 
南極之旅
南極之旅南極之旅
南極之旅
 
人体藝術
人体藝術人体藝術
人体藝術
 
8.2 la monarquía hispánica de felipe ii
8.2 la monarquía hispánica de felipe ii8.2 la monarquía hispánica de felipe ii
8.2 la monarquía hispánica de felipe ii
 
春天來臨九族村 -王英明攝
春天來臨九族村 -王英明攝春天來臨九族村 -王英明攝
春天來臨九族村 -王英明攝
 
俄羅斯
俄羅斯俄羅斯
俄羅斯
 
椅子正在謀殺你
椅子正在謀殺你椅子正在謀殺你
椅子正在謀殺你
 
1百花盛開
1百花盛開1百花盛開
1百花盛開
 
花卉的藝術
花卉的藝術花卉的藝術
花卉的藝術
 
明仕田
明仕田明仕田
明仕田
 
獨特的地方
獨特的地方獨特的地方
獨特的地方
 
彩筆下的威尼斯
彩筆下的威尼斯彩筆下的威尼斯
彩筆下的威尼斯
 
Lope
Lope Lope
Lope
 

Semelhante a Tarea 4 software

Semelhante a Tarea 4 software (20)

sofwuare
sofwuaresofwuare
sofwuare
 
Software
SoftwareSoftware
Software
 
actividad_10
actividad_10actividad_10
actividad_10
 
Soportes logicos
Soportes logicosSoportes logicos
Soportes logicos
 
Que es el Software?
Que es el Software?Que es el Software?
Que es el Software?
 
Schultz software
Schultz softwareSchultz software
Schultz software
 
Schultz software
Schultz softwareSchultz software
Schultz software
 
Schultz software
Schultz softwareSchultz software
Schultz software
 
Software
SoftwareSoftware
Software
 
Introducción a la Programación.
Introducción a la Programación.Introducción a la Programación.
Introducción a la Programación.
 
Ensayo de software
Ensayo de softwareEnsayo de software
Ensayo de software
 
Diferentes tipos de software que se aplica
Diferentes tipos de software que se aplicaDiferentes tipos de software que se aplica
Diferentes tipos de software que se aplica
 
Tipos de software
Tipos de softwareTipos de software
Tipos de software
 
Exposición software
Exposición softwareExposición software
Exposición software
 
Presentac..
Presentac..Presentac..
Presentac..
 
trabajo epico :3
trabajo epico :3trabajo epico :3
trabajo epico :3
 
Sofware y su clasificacion
Sofware y su clasificacion Sofware y su clasificacion
Sofware y su clasificacion
 
Informatica- Sofware
Informatica- SofwareInformatica- Sofware
Informatica- Sofware
 
Informatica- Sofware
Informatica- SofwareInformatica- Sofware
Informatica- Sofware
 
Informatica- Sofware
Informatica- SofwareInformatica- Sofware
Informatica- Sofware
 

Tarea 4 software

  • 1.
  • 3.
  • 4. Los componentes lógicos incluyen, entre muchos otros, las aplicaciones informáticas; tales como el procesador de textos, que permite al usuario realizar todas las tareas concernientes a la edición de textos; el software de sistema, tal como el sistema operativo, que, básicamente, permite al resto de los programas funcionar adecuadamente, facilitando también la interacción entre los componentes físicos y el resto de las aplicaciones, y proporcionando una interfaz para el usuario.
  • 5. ETIMOLOGÍA Software (pronunciación AFI:[soft'ɣware])es una palabra proveniente del inglés (literalmente: partes blandas o suaves), que en español no posee una traducción adecuada al contexto, por lo cual se la utiliza asiduamente sin traducir y así fue admitida por la Real Academia Española (RAE).Aunque no es estrictamente lo mismo, suele sustituirse por expresiones tales como programas (informáticos) o aplicaciones (informáticas). Software es lo que se denomina producto en Ingeniería de Software
  • 6. DEFINICIÓN DE SOFTWARE Existen varias definiciones similares aceptadas para software, pero probablemente la más formal sea la siguiente: Es el conjunto de los programas de cómputo, procedimientos, reglas, documentación y datos asociados que forman parte de las operaciones de un sistema de computación.
  • 7. Considerando esta definición, el concepto de software va más allá de los programas de computación en sus distintos estados: código fuente, binario o ejecutable; también su documentación, los datos a procesar e incluso la información de usuario forman parte del software: es decir, abarca todo lo intangible, todo lo «no físico» relacionado. El término «software» fue usado por primera vez en este sentido por John W. Tukey en 1957. En la ingeniería de software y las ciencias de la computación, el software es toda la información procesada por los sistemas informáticos: programas y datos. El concepto de leer diferentes secuencias de instrucciones (programa) desde la memoria de un dispositivo para controlar los cálculos fue introducido por Charles Babbage como parte de su máquina diferencial. La teoría que forma la base de la mayor parte del software moderno fue propuesta por Alan Turing en su ensayo de 1936, «Los números computables», con una aplicación al problema de decisión.
  • 8. CLASIFICACIÓN DEL SOFTWARE Software de sistema: Su objetivo es desvincular adecuadamente al usuario y al programador de los detalles de la computadora en particular que se use, aislándolo especialmente del procesamiento referido a las características internas de: memoria, discos, puertos y dispositivos de comunicaciones, impresoras, pantallas, teclados, etc. El software de sistema le procura al usuario y programador adecuadas interfaces de alto nivel, herramientas y utilidades de apoyo que permiten su mantenimiento. Incluye entre otros: Sistemas operativos Controladores de dispositivos Herramientas de diagnóstico Herramientas de Corrección y Optimización Servidores Utilidades
  • 9.
  • 14.
  • 15. PROCESO DE CREACIÓN DEL SOFTWARE Se define como Proceso al conjunto ordenado de pasos a seguir para llegar a la solución de un problema u obtención de un producto, en este caso particular, para lograr la obtención de un producto software que resuelva un problema. El proceso de creación de software puede llegar a ser muy complejo, dependiendo de su porte, características y criticidad del mismo. Por ejemplo la creación de un sistema operativo es una tarea que requiere proyecto, gestión, numerosos recursos y todo un equipo disciplinado de trabajo. En el otro extremo, si se trata de un sencillo programa (por ejemplo, la resolución de una ecuación de segundo orden), éste puede ser realizado por un solo programador (incluso aficionado) fácilmente. Es así que normalmente se dividen en tres categorías según su tamaño (líneas de código) o costo: de Pequeño, Mediano y Gran porte. Existen varias metodologías para estimarlo, una de las más populares es el sistema COCOMO que provee métodos y un software (programa) que calcula y provee una estimación de todos los costos de producción en un «proyecto software» (relación horas/hombre, costo monetario, cantidad de líneas fuente de acuerdo a lenguaje usado, etc.).
  • 16. ETAPAS EN EL DESARROLLO DEL SOFTWARE Las bondades de las características, tanto del sistema o programa a desarrollar, como de su entorno, parámetros no funcionales y arquitectura dependen enormemente de lo bien lograda que esté esta etapa. Esta es, probablemente, la de mayor importancia y una de las fases más difíciles de lograr certeramente, pues no es automatizable, no es muy técnica y depende en gran medida de la habilidad y experiencia del analista que la realice. Involucra fuertemente al usuario o cliente del sistema, por tanto tiene matices muy subjetivos y es difícil de modelar con certeza o aplicar una técnica que sea «la más cercana a la adecuada» (de hecho no existe «la estrictamente adecuada»). Si bien se han ideado varias metodologías, incluso software de apoyo, para captura, elicitación y registro de requisitos, no existe una forma infalible o absolutamente confiable, y deben aplicarse conjuntamente buenos criterios y mucho sentido común por parte del o los analistas encargados de la tarea; es fundamental también lograr una fluida y adecuada comunicación y comprensión con el usuario final o cliente del sistema.